Ouagadougou

Ouagadougou, more commonly known as Ouaga, is the capital and largest city of Burkina Faso. Additionally, the city is the administrative, communications, cultural, and economic center of the nation. Ouagadougou’s primary industries are food processing and textiles.

Even though the architecture here is not particularly inspiring and the sights will leave you underwhelmed (except for the impressive Roman Catholic cathedral), the city is a true hive of performing arts inspiration. Dance, live music, awesome festivals, and craft markets make for a memorable and rewarding travel experience and make a trip to Ouaga worthwhile.

Arli National Park

Arli National Park, often called Arly, is a national park located in Tapoa Province, south-eastern Burkina Faso. The national park is one of four in Burkina Faso, occupies an area of around 700 kmand is home to thousands of animals.

Some of the species that call the park their home include lions, antelopes, monkeys and hippos. Formerly the park was home to the African wild dog although it is thought that, due to the expanding human population and other factors, the species may have been wiped out in the area. The watering hole in Tounga is one of the park’s most reliable and popular animal-watching spots and draws a variety of wildlife year-round.

Banfora

Banfora is situated in one of the most beautiful regions of Burkina Faso, the Comoe Province.

The town is not much of a draw for tourists in itself but the location is perfect; the nearby attractions include Tengrela Lake, which is a great place to spot hippos, especially in the dry season, and the Karfiguela Waterfalls which make for a great hiking or picnic spot.
